Wedding Venues in Southern Oregon- Chateau Herbe in Ashland Oregon

Luxury comes to Southern Oregon. The first time I saw pictures of this venue I was stunned. I knew immediately that I just had to photograph weddings here & help to get the word out on this lovely Southern Oregon Wedding Venue. I teamed up with several other vendors, including the incredible Events with Becca that styled this whole shoot- & I toured & photographed this gorgeous place. Tucked into gorgeous Ashland, Oregon this venue offers a sweeping and vast property full of beauty and so many amazing places to capture your wedding day - a wedding photographers dream! I hope this tour for potential brides & grooms will be helpful!

Some quick & helpful info from the website about what the venue offers:

-27 acres

-rose garden

-manicured lawns

-tables & chairs included in the price

-dance floor included

-bridal suite

From the Venue Owners:

The Chateau Herbe is a unique estate with a European flair nestled in beautiful Ashland Oregon. It had been one of thee best kept secrets until recently. As soon as Thaddeus and Rebecca saw it they knew it would make a stunning venue for brides who wanted a fairytale look.

The property boast hand carved marble statues, a replica of the Chateau Herbe in France, expansive manicured grounds and gorgeous views of the mountains.

We love sharing the property so others can enjoy Europe in Southern Oregon.

This stunning view at the front of the property, immaculately maintained and a true work of architectural art is a sight to behold and will be the first thing your guests see on arrival. I can only imagine all the magical weddings that will happen here. As a photographer I loved the lighting here. Beautiful light in the front here lends to that European feel in the images and captures such magic. While the front is in shade the back is in sun so you can time your wedding photos perfectly to take advantage of the full property.

Equally as gorgeous is the back half of the property where weddings take place on the lawn- on one end the back view of the chateau and at the other a lovely French inspired rotunda. On either side of the lawn you have gorgeous tree lined walks perfect for cocktail hour and an incredible trebuchet fountain.


Inside, options for taking bridal or couples images are endless, from the stunning getting ready room with lots of soft light to the timeless downstairs green room full of amazing pieces of art and furniture.
